How Get Rid of Arrest Records in Wichita with Expert Expungement Guidance Actually Works
Expungement refers to the legal process of sealing or destroying arrest and trial records so they are generally not visible during background checks. In Kansas, eligibility depends on the specific charge, the outcome of the case, and the amount of time that has passed since the incident. For some misdemeanor charges and dismissed charges, individuals may qualify for expungement after a waiting period, often three to four years, with no additional arrests. More serious offenses, such as felonies or crimes involving victims, typically face stricter rules or may not be eligible at all. Because laws can be nuanced, many people rely on a structured "Get Rid of Arrest Records in Wichita with Expert Expungement Guidance" approach to understand their specific situation.
The process usually begins with obtaining court records and case dispositions, either through the local courthouse or online portals used by the state. These documents show whether an arrest led to a charge, a conviction, or a dismissal, which directly affects eligibility. Many individuals choose to work with professionals who are familiar with Kansas statutes and local court procedures to avoid delays caused by incomplete paperwork or missed deadlines. Filing a petition for expungement involves preparing specific forms, paying court fees, and sometimes attending a brief hearing. While some motivated applicants complete this journey on their own, others prefer guided support to navigate terminology, procedural steps, and potential objections from prosecutors.
Common Questions People Have About Get Rid of Arrest Records in Wichita with Expert Expungement Guidance
A frequent question is how long an expungement process takes in Wichita. Timelines can vary based on court schedules, the complexity of the case, and whether all required documents are submitted correctly. Simple cases may move relatively quickly, while those involving court hearings or additional legal steps can take several months. Another common concern involves costs, which include filing fees, potential attorney fees, and the value of time spent learning the process. People often wonder whether expungement completely removes a record or merely restricts access. In most cases, sealed records are hidden from public view and standard background checks, though certain government agencies may still have access under specific circumstances.
Many also ask how expungement differs from setting aside or vacating a conviction. While these terms are sometimes used interchangeably, they refer to distinct legal actions. Expungement generally applies to arrests that did not result in a conviction or qualify for sealing under Kansas law, whereas setting aside a conviction often requires completing a sentence, demonstrating rehabilitation, and receiving court approval. Another misconception is that once an arrest occurred, it will follow a person forever. In reality, Kansas law provides pathways to limit the visibility of records, which can dramatically improve job prospects, housing applications, and personal peace of mind. Understanding these distinctions helps people set realistic expectations and choose the right path.

Things People Often Misunderstand About Expungement
One widespread myth is that expungement is only for people who were found not guilty. In reality, many qualified cases involve dismissed charges, reduced charges, or successful probation outcomes. Another misunderstanding is that once a record is sealed, it is as if the incident never happened. While access is restricted, certain agencies and situations may still reveal information, and honesty may still be required on specific forms or applications. Some also assume that expungement fixes every consequence of an arrest, but professional licenses, military service, or immigration matters sometimes require additional steps or disclosures. Clarifying these points helps people avoid disappointment and make informed decisions.
